How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Albert?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Albert Studio Apartments | $731 | $621 | $854 |
Albert 1 Bedroom Apartments | $952 | $525 | $1,700 |
Albert 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,113 | $580 | $2,300 |
Albert 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,353 | $480 | $2,025 |
Albert 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,446 | $455 | $2,025 |
